Report: Why Antonio Conte was delighted to see Kane and others struggling in Tottenham’s pre-season drills

Add as preferred source on Google

Antonio Conte has been building a bit of a reputation recently at Tottenham after fans got to witness snippets of his brutal pre-season training regimes.

As has been pointed out by many a journalist and seen by snippets of video doing the rounds online, Conte put his Spurs players through their paces over in Korea as he got them ready for the new season. Notably, there were top players like Harry Kane and Heung-Min Son essentially keeling over at times, while other players were said to have been sick due to the amount of running.

But while some might see this as training to the extreme, The Independent’s Miguel Delaney has reported today how deep down, Antonio Conte and his staff loved what they were seeing, and with good intentions at heart.

“As the Tottenham Hotspur players like Harry Kane and Heung Min-Son collapsed to the ground after gruelling pre-season runs, there were smiles of relish on the faces of Antonio Conte and his staff. It wasn’t just that the squad were suffering for their benefit, although there was obviously a mischievous element. It was mostly how they were being honed, toughened,” Delaney writes in his column today.

“Such military-like training all played into Conte’s belief that his teams, as an ideal, should be “small war machines”. It was a phrase he first used in his first pre-season with Chelsea back in 2016, before their first title. It is also something that Spurs are now starting to resemble, after his first pre-season at White Hart Lane. There is a belief within the team that they are ready to take on Chelsea, and take all three points. That is something that hasn’t happened much in recent history, as Conte knows too well.”
